What should I do if my AC's condensate drain line is clogged in my Orlando home?

If you notice water pooling around your indoor AC unit or hear gurgling sounds, it's likely a clogged condensate drain line—common in Orlando's humid climate. First, turn off your AC to prevent water damage. You can try clearing it with a wet/dry vacuum at the outdoor drain port, but for a thorough fix, call One Stop Cooling & Heating. Our technicians use specialized tools to clear blockages and apply preventive treatments to avoid future clogs, protecting your system and home.

How can I tell if my thermostat is malfunctioning and needs repair in Orlando?

Signs of a faulty thermostat in Orlando include inconsistent temperatures, unresponsive controls, or your HVAC system not turning on/off properly. Before calling us, check if it's set to 'cool' or 'heat,' replace batteries if wireless, and ensure it's clean and level. If issues persist, our experts at One Stop Cooling & Heating can diagnose problems—from wiring issues to sensor failures—and provide repairs or upgrades to smart thermostats for better efficiency in our local climate.
